Driver hospitalized after pickup crashes 3 separate times on Lafayette Street

FORT WAYNE, Ind. (WANE) Investigators are working to determine what caused a driver to crash three separate times south of downtown Monday afternoon.

A woman was driving a pickup truck on Lafayette Street south of Paulding Road when the truck first veered off the street, hitting a fence line and several trees, according to a press release from the Fort Wayne Police Department. The driver then pulled away and continued north on Lafayette.

Witnesses recalled seeing an “erratic” truck on the road that wasn’t able to travel in a straight line. The truck’s second collision involved rear-ending a car off Lafayette near McKinnie Avenue. Police said the truck briefly stopped; the driver of the rear-ended car was reportedly not hurt and the damage was minor…
